QIPP plan
NHS South East Essex published an integrated QIPP (Quality, Innovation, Productivity and Prevention) plan at its last board meeting (29 September 2011) which details how the whole health system will make productivity savings in light of the difficult financial climate, without compromising patient care.

Vital Signs 2010-11
This performance data gives an overview of how NHS South East Essex has performed in relation to the Vital Signs indicators for the NHS and how this compares with the rest of the East of England and the national picture. The information within the paper will inform future discussions and consultations with our partners and with patients and the public, to help determine the future priorities for local health care and health improvement.
